OLIGOMYCIN C Chemical Properties,Uses,Production

Description

Oligomycins are macrolides created by Streptomyces species that can be toxic to other organisms. Different oligomycin isomers are highly specific for the disruption of mitochondrial metabolism. Oligomycin C is a minor component of the oligomycin complex that acts as an inhibitor of the mitochondrial F1FO-ATP synthase. Inhibition of the ATP synthase by oligomycins leads to cell death.

Uses

Oligomycin C, a minor component of the oligomycin complex isolated from selected strains of Streptomyces, is an inhibitor of mitochondrial F1F0-ATPase. It makes cells more susceptible to cell death, and also leads to a switch in the death mode from apoptosis to necrosis.
